Sistema de reconhecimento de voz e sua operação de trabalho

Experimente Nosso Instrumento Para Eliminar Problemas





O sistema de reconhecimento de voz é a capacidade de um dispositivo ou programa de receber e compreender ditados ou de compreender uma instrução falada. Quando este sistema é usado com um computador, sinal analógico deve ser convertido em digital usando ADC . Em um computador, um banco de dados digital, sílabas e vocabulário de palavras e sílabas são necessários para decodificar o sinal. As formas da fala são armazenadas no disco rígido e carregadas na memória quando o programa é executado. Os formulários armazenados são verificados pelo computador em relação ao o / p do conversor analógico para digital. Todos os tipos de sistemas de reconhecimento de voz não produzem uma saída precisa. Porque cães latindo, gritos de crianças e sons externos altos podem gerar falso i / p.

Esses tipos de voz podem ser reconhecidos apenas usando o sistema de reconhecimento de voz em uma sala silenciosa. Há também alguns problemas com algumas palavras que produzem sons semelhantes, como here & hear. Para superar este problema, este sistema requer processadores e RAMs mais rápidos que estão disponíveis nos computadores pessoais. No entanto, esses sistemas estão disponíveis no mercado e também os líderes da indústria de sistemas de reconhecimento de voz são Dragon System e IBM.




Sistema de segurança de reconhecimento de voz

Sistema de segurança de reconhecimento de voz

Sistema de segurança de reconhecimento de voz

O conceito principal deste projeto é projetar um reconhecimento de voz sistema de segurança . Este projeto é usado principalmente para fins de segurança para identificar a senha de voz falada pela pessoa autorizada e o sistema abre quando a senha está correta. Este sistema será controlado por Microcontrolador PIC que pode ser programado em linguagem assembly ou linguagem C.



Classificação do Sistema de Reconhecimento de Voz

O sistema de reconhecimento de voz é classificado em quatro tipos, como VRS isolado, VRS contínuo, VRS dependente de alto-falante e VRS independente de alto-falante.

Classificação do Sistema de Reconhecimento de Voz

Classificação do Sistema de Reconhecimento de Voz

  • VRS isolado requer uma breve passagem b / n as palavras faladas
  • VRS contínuo não exige uma breve passagem b / n as palavras faladas
  • O VRS dependente de alto-falante identifica a fala de apenas um alto-falante
  • O VRS independente do alto-falante identifica a fala de qualquer pessoa.

Projeto de Hardware do Sistema de Segurança de Reconhecimento de Voz

Este projeto de Sistema de Segurança de Reconhecimento de Voz é projetado com três elementos principais, como circuito de microfone, microcontrolador e tela de LCD A concepção deste projeto de sistema de segurança de reconhecimento de voz é muito fácil. O circuito do microfone é conectado ao circuito analógico para digital do microcontrolador PIC. A palavra digitalizada passou pelos filtros digitais. O processo da coruja é feito no microcontrolador, uma vez feito o processo, o display LCD é conectado ao microcontrolador para exibir se a palavra falada corresponde ou não à senha embutida.

Módulo de Reconhecimento de Voz

Módulo de Reconhecimento de Voz

Microfone ou Mike

Um microfone, às vezes denominado como um microfone ou microfone, é um sensor ou transdutor que é usado para converter o som em um sinal elétrico. As aplicações do microfone envolvem principalmente gravadores, rádios, transmissão de TVs, telefones. Em um microfone capacitor também conhecido como microfone condensador, o diafragma atua como um terminal do capacitor e a vibração muda na distância entre os dois terminais. Para extrair um áudio o / p do transdutor, existem dois métodos conhecidos como microfones DC polarizados e HF ou RF condensador.


Unidade Microcontroladora

MCU é um computador em um chip e possui baixo consumo de energia, autossuficiência e alta integração. O microcontrolador normalmente integra elementos extras como ROM para armazenamento de código, memória R / W para armazenar as interfaces de E / S de dados e dispositivos periféricos. Este MCU consome menos energia e geralmente tem a capacidade de dormir enquanto espera por outro evento periférico, como quando um botão é pressionado para acordá-los e fazer algo novamente.

PIC 18F8720

PIC 18F8720

Os microcontroladores são frequentemente usados ​​em dispositivos e produtos controlados automaticamente, como controles remotos, sistemas de controle do motor de automóveis, ferramentas elétricas, máquinas de escritório, brinquedos e eletrodomésticos. Ao reduzir o custo, tamanho e consumo de energia em comparação com outros dispositivos de E / S, microprocessador, memória e microcontroladores tornam mais barato controlar muitos processos eletronicamente.

Computador de placa única - Atmega32

ATmega321644 é um pequeno computador com placa única baseado na família Atmel, como ATmega32 ou Atmel ATmega644 Processador AVR . Esta placa foi projetada com a cooperação de Holger Bu, Ulrich Radig e Thomas Scherer, com a primeira intenção de controlar remotamente uma máquina de café pela Internet.

Computador de placa única - Atmega32

Computador de placa única - Atmega32

Este computador de placa única suporta até 2048 bytes de RAM. Inclui um sistema operacional integrado especialmente projetado. Embora bastante relacionado ao ECB-ATmega321644 e ao ECB-AT91, possui características individuais. Ele opera na faixa de consumo mínimo de energia inferior a 100 mA. Ele ainda é usado como um servidor web para monitorar a webcam, controle remoto baseado na web. Porém, com pouca potência, a capacidade do servidor web é baixa e principalmente o dispositivo é voltado para uso de baixa intensidade.

Tela de LCD

Uma tela de cristal líquido (LCD) é uma tela plana e fina e é composta de pixels monocromáticos dispostos na frente de um refletor. É freqüentemente usado em dispositivos eletrônicos, que são alimentados por bateria. Porque inclui uma pequena quantidade de energia. O display LCD usado neste projeto é do tipo alfanumérico que exibe caracteres alfabéticos, simbólicos e numéricos do conjunto de caracteres ASCII padrão. Este tipo de monitor também exibe gráficos de baixa resolução.

Tela de LCD

Tela de LCD

Desenvolvimento de software

Multisim 2001

A ferramenta Multisim 2001 é usada para projetar um sistema e oferece uma grande quantidade de banco de dados, entrada esquemática, simulação, projeto VHDL, síntese de FPGAICPLD, recursos de RF, pós-processamento etc. Esta ferramenta fornece uma interface gráfica única e fácil de usar para todos os projetos e oferece funções avançadas, mas você precisa retirar os designs da produção. Porque, o programa integra layout de PCB, lógica programável, captura esquemática e simulação.

Multisim 2001

Multisim 2001

  • Suporta todo o processo de projeto do circuito, incluindo a inserção do projeto na ferramenta de software usada
  • Verificando o comportamento do circuito, isso é feito usando simulação e análise.
  • Modificar o projeto do circuito, se o comportamento do circuito atender às expectativas.

Por exemplo, se ele deve ser localizado em um placa de circuito impresso , a próxima etapa é usar um programa de layout PCB (produto Ultiboard da Electronics Workbench). Se for para ser localizado em um PLD (dispositivo lógico programável) ou CPLD ou FPGA a próxima etapa é usar uma ferramenta de síntese, que está disponível no Electronics Workbench.

É tudo sobre sistema de reconhecimento de voz e seu funcionamento. Esperamos que você tenha entendido melhor este conceito. Além disso, qualquer dúvida sobre este tópico ou módulos de reconhecimento de voz , dê sua opinião comentando na seção de comentários abaixo. Aqui fica uma pergunta para você, quais são as aplicações do sistema de reconhecimento de voz.

Créditos fotográficos:

  • Sistema de segurança de reconhecimento de voz por Zeendo
  • Módulo de reconhecimento de voz por imimg
  • ATmega321644 por thinnkware
  • Multisim 2001 por downza